Dallas Cowboys quarterback Dak Prescott finished second in the AP voting for the NFL’s MVP award in the 2023 season, but he’s not expected to finish as high in 2024, according to the opening odds. 

FanDuel Sportsbook has Prescott at +1600 to win the MVP, behind Patrick Mahomes, Joe Burrow, Josh Allen, CJ Stroud, Lamar Jackson, Justin Herbert and Jordan Love. It’s interesting that Love is the only NFC quarterback ahead of Prescott. 

The Cowboys signal-caller is also tied with Philadelphia Eagles quarterback Jalen Hurts in the latest MVP odds, something that Dallas fans certainly won’t like to see. 

Prescott had a great season in 2023, throwing for a league-best 36 touchdowns while only tossing nine interceptions. He also led the league in completions. 

Dallas’ playoff failure – losing to Love and the Packers on Wild Card Weekend – may have soured oddsmakers on Dak coming into 2024. Does that give him value? 

Dak Prescott 2024 NFL MVP odds

I think there is an argument to be made for betting on Prescott to win the MVP award this season. 

Since the NFC seems wide open (Hurts, Brock Purdy and Dak are all tied at +1600 in the MVP odds), there’s a chance Dallas could end up the No. 1 seed in the conference. Plus, with most of the top candidates for MVP being in the AFC, there’s a good chance they cannibalize each other in the market. 

Burrow and Jackson, as well as Mahomes and Herbert, will likely eliminate two of the group because they all can’t win their respective divisions. We’ve seen in recent seasons that voters are likely to give the MVP to a quarterback on a team with the best – or one of the best – records in the NFL. 

Prescott threw the ball a ton in 2023, a recipe for him putting up strong passing numbers. If he can keep his interceptions down again, Dak has the system around him to finish amongst the top players in the MVP race.

Jalen Hurts 2024 NFL MVP odds

It’s interesting to see Hurts in the same spot as Prescott, especially after the Eagles’ offense faded in the 2023 season. 

Hurts finished with just 23 touchdown passes and he threw a career-high 15 interceptions. While the Eagles quarterback does bring a different dynamic with his legs, is it disrespectful to put him this close to Prescott, who was No. 2 in MVP voting in 2023? 

Oddsmakers seem to have these two players linked as the one who wins the NFC East will undoubtedly have the better case for MVP in the 2024 campaign.
